Implementing effective micro-targeted A/B testing requires more than just segmenting your audience; it demands a meticulous, data-driven approach that combines advanced segmentation, precise technical setup, and continuous optimization. This guide provides a comprehensive, step-by-step framework to execute micro-targeted tests that yield actionable insights and substantial conversion gains, moving beyond surface-level tactics to expert-level mastery.
Table of Contents
- Understanding Micro-Targeted A/B Testing Strategies for Conversion Optimization
- Data Collection and Segmentation for Precise Micro-Targets
- Designing Micro-Targeted Variations: Techniques and Best Practices
- Technical Setup for Micro-Targeted A/B Testing
- Running and Managing Micro-Targeted A/B Tests: Execution and Optimization
- Analyzing Results and Drawing Actionable Conclusions
- Avoiding Common Pitfalls in Micro-Targeted A/B Testing
- Final Integration: Leveraging Micro-Targeted Testing to Broaden Conversion Optimization
1. Understanding Micro-Targeted A/B Testing Strategies for Conversion Optimization
a) Defining Micro-Targeting in the Context of A/B Testing
Micro-targeting in A/B testing refers to the practice of creating highly specific user segments based on granular behavioral, demographic, or contextual data, then tailoring variations explicitly for these groups. Unlike broad A/B tests that compare general variants across a wide audience, micro-targeted tests focus on narrow slices—such as users who abandoned their cart after viewing a product page but not completing purchase, or visitors from a specific referral source exhibiting particular browsing patterns.
b) Differentiating Micro-Targeted Tests from Broader A/B Campaigns
The key distinction lies in scope and personalization depth. Broad A/B tests typically evaluate generic changes—like button color or headline phrasing—across all visitors. Micro-targeted tests, however, modify content, messaging, or flow based on user attributes, creating personalized experiences that resonate more deeply with individual segments. For example, a micro-test might test different product recommendations for users who previously viewed similar items, whereas a broad test might compare two homepage layouts.
c) Key Benefits and Limitations of Micro-Targeting for Conversion Gains
| Benefits | Limitations |
|---|---|
| Increases relevance, boosting engagement and conversions | Requires sophisticated data collection and management systems |
| Enhances personalization, fostering customer loyalty | Potential for data privacy concerns if not managed properly |
| Can identify niche opportunities missed by broad testing | Sample size limitations in highly specific segments may hinder statistical significance |
2. Data Collection and Segmentation for Precise Micro-Targets
a) Identifying High-Impact User Segments Using Behavioral Data
Start by analyzing your existing analytics data—using tools like Google Analytics, Mixpanel, or Heap—to identify user behaviors correlated with desired outcomes. Focus on actions such as repeat visits, cart abandonment, time spent on specific pages, or engagement with certain features. Use cohort analysis to track how specific groups behave over time, revealing patterns that can inform segmentation.
b) Implementing Advanced Segmentation Techniques (e.g., Cohort Analysis, Heatmaps)
Leverage cohort analysis to group users based on shared characteristics—such as acquisition date, source, or behavior triggers—and observe their interactions over time. Incorporate heatmaps (via tools like Hotjar or Crazy Egg) to visualize where users click, scroll, or hesitate, uncovering subtle engagement cues. Use these insights to define micro-segments, such as users who have viewed a product multiple times but haven’t purchased, or visitors who bounce quickly after certain interactions.
c) Ensuring Data Accuracy and Privacy Compliance in Micro-Targeting
Implement rigorous data validation protocols—such as cross-referencing multiple data sources—and clean your datasets regularly to avoid segment contamination. Use server-side tagging and secure data storage to enhance accuracy. Always adhere to privacy regulations like GDPR and CCPA by obtaining explicit user consent, anonymizing personal data, and providing clear opt-out options. Employ privacy-friendly tracking methods, such as first-party cookies and hashed identifiers, to maintain compliance while gathering granular data.
3. Designing Micro-Targeted Variations: Techniques and Best Practices
a) How to Create Variations That Resonate with Specific User Segments
Develop variations that address the unique motivations or pain points of each segment. For instance, for users who viewed a product but did not purchase, emphasize social proof or limited-time discounts. Use dynamic content blocks that pull in personalized messages or product recommendations based on segment data. Implement A/B variation templates that are modular, allowing quick adjustments tailored to each micro-segment.
b) Leveraging Personalization to Enhance Micro-Targeted Tests
Utilize personalization engines integrated with your testing platform—such as Optimizely’s Personalization or VWO’s Personalization features—to deliver tailored variations. For example, show different headlines, images, or CTAs based on user attributes like location, device, or previous interactions. Create rules that trigger specific variations only for targeted segments, ensuring content relevance and maximizing conversion potential.
c) Avoiding Over-Segmentation: Balancing Granularity and Actionability
While micro-segmentation can be powerful, excessive splitting leads to small sample sizes and complex management. Use the 80/20 rule: focus on segments that yield the highest impact or have sufficient volume for reliable testing. Group similar behaviors or demographics to consolidate variations without sacrificing personalization quality. Regularly review segment performance and prune underperforming or overly niche groups.
4. Technical Setup for Micro-Targeted A/B Testing
a) Selecting the Right Testing Platform for Micro-Targeting (e.g., Optimizely, VWO, Google Optimize)
Choose a platform that supports advanced audience targeting, real-time segment switching, and server-side testing capabilities. Optimizely and VWO provide robust APIs and SDKs for dynamic content delivery, enabling precise control over who sees what variation. Google Optimize offers native integration with Google Analytics and supports custom JavaScript for segment-based targeting, ideal for smaller-scale implementations.
b) Implementing Dynamic Content Delivery Based on User Attributes
Embed conditional logic within your website code or via your testing platform’s API. For example, use JavaScript to check user cookies or dataLayer variables, then load specific variation content accordingly:
c) Configuring Test Conditions and Audience Triggers for Precise Targeting
Set up audience triggers within your testing platform to automatically assign users to segments based on defined criteria—such as URL parameters, behavioral events, or demographic data. Use custom JavaScript variables or URL query strings to flag certain groups:
// Example: Trigger based on URL parameter
if (window.location.search.includes('segment=high_value')) {
assignToSegment('high_value');
}
d) Step-by-Step: Setting Up a Micro-Targeted Test Campaign with Code Snippets and Tagging
- Identify your segments: Define segment criteria—e.g., user actions, source, or demographic data.
- Implement data capture: Use custom dataLayer variables or cookies to store segment info.
- Configure your testing platform: Set audience triggers based on your data capture methods.
- Create variations: Develop content variations tailored for each segment.
- Implement dynamic content code: Use JavaScript snippets to serve variations dynamically.
- Tag and monitor: Use UTM parameters or custom tags to track segment performance in analytics dashboards.
5. Running and Managing Micro-Targeted A/B Tests: Execution and Optimization
a) Monitoring Segment-Specific Performance Metrics in Real-Time
Use your testing platform’s real-time dashboards to track key KPIs—such as conversion rate, bounce rate, or engagement metrics—per segment. Set up custom alerts for significant deviations or early success signals. For example, VWO’s JavaScript API allows you to log segment-specific events and visualize data instantly.
b) Troubleshooting Common Technical Issues (e.g., Segment Leakage, Incorrect Targeting)
Tip: Always verify your segment definitions with real user data before launching. Use browser debugging tools to ensure scripts load correctly. For segment leakage issues, audit your targeting conditions and consider server-side tagging to enforce strict audience boundaries.
Regularly test your setup with sample users and use network monitoring tools to confirm that only intended segments see specific variations. Implement fallback mechanisms for users who do not meet segment criteria to prevent misclassification.
c) Adjusting Variations Based on Early Data Insights—When and How
Set predefined thresholds for early stopping—such as a minimum sample size or a statistically significant uplift. Use Bayesian or frequentist significance tests suited for small samples, like Fisher’s Exact Test, to evaluate early results. Adjust variations by iterating on messaging, layout, or offers based on segment-specific performance. Avoid overfitting: make incremental tweaks and document each change for future analysis.
d) Case Study: Successful Micro-Targeted Test Implementation and Results
A SaaS provider targeted high-intent visitors—those who engaged with trial pages but did not convert—by creating a personalized variation offering a limited-time discount. Using segment-specific messaging and dynamic countdown timers, they achieved a 15% increase in trial sign-ups within two weeks. Key to success was meticulous data segmentation, real-time monitoring, and iterative optimization based on early insights.
6. Analyzing Results and Drawing Actionable Conclusions
a) Comparing Segment-Specific Conversion Data Accurately
Use segmented analytics reports—either within your testing platform or external tools like Tableau—to compare conversion rates, engagement, and revenue across segments. Normalize data for size differences, and apply confidence intervals to understand the reliability of your results. For example, a 2% lift in a segment with only 50 users may not be statistically significant, unlike the same lift in a larger segment.
b) Using Statistical Significance Tests for Small, Niche Segments
Apply exact tests such as Fisher’s Exact Test or Bayesian A/B testing methods, which are more reliable for small sample sizes. Use tools like Optimizely’s built-in significance calculator or statistical software (e.g., R, Python) to validate your findings. Always set your significance threshold (e.g., p < 0.05) before interpreting results to avoid biases.
c) Identifying Notable Patterns and Insights for Personalization Strategies
Look for consistent uplift trends within segments and analyze behavioral differences—such as time to conversion or interaction depth—that correlate with success. Use these insights to refine your broader personalization strategy, creating scalable rules based on micro-segment learnings.
d) Documenting and Sharing Findings to Inform Broader Optimization Efforts
Create detailed reports that include segment definitions, test variations, performance metrics, and conclusions. Share these insights across teams—marketing, product, CX—to align on effective personalization tactics. Incorporate lessons learned into your overarching CRO framework to continually evolve your micro-targeting approach.
